A 30-cm-OD pipe with a surface temperature of 90?C carries steam over a distance of 100 m. The pipe is buried with its center line at a depth of 1 m, the ground surface is ?? 6?C, and the mean thermal conductivity of the soil is 0.7 W/(m K). Calculate the heat loss per day, and the cost, if steam heat is worth $3.00 per 106 kJ.
